In mindfulness, calm is having a quiet mind and a peaceful body, noticing your feelings without getting swept away by them.
In mindfulness, focus is like having a superhero cape for your attention, letting you choose what you pay attention to, one thing at a time.
In mindfulness, happy is like sunshine in your tummy, noticing the good things and feeling content just as you are.
